#40107A Color
#40107A is rgb(64, 16, 122) in RGB, hsl(267, 77%, 27%) in HSL, and about cmyk(48%, 87%, 0%, 52%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Persian Indigo (#32127A),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.56.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#40107A Channel Values
How #40107A bre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 64 · G 16 · B 122 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 267° · S 77% · L 27%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 267° · S 87% · V 48%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 48% · M 87% · Y 0% · K 52%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 13.35:1 vs white · 1.57: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#40107A background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#40107A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#40107A?
#40107A is a dark purple — rgb(64, 16, 122) in RGB and hsl(267, 77%, 27%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Persian Indigo (#32127A),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.56.
What is the RGB value of #40107A?
#40107A is rgb(64, 16, 122) — red 64, green 16, and blue 122 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#40107A?
#40107A converts to approximately cmyk(48%, 87%, 0%, 52%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#40107A be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#40107A scores 13.35:1 against white and 1.57: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#40107A as a CSS color keyword?
No. #40107A is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is indigo (#4B0082) at a CIE76 distance of 8.52,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
